At Arrive AI (
Nasdaq:
ARAI), we're not just building products—we're transforming the future of the Autonomous Last Mile™ (ALM). Over a decade ago, we started with a pioneering vision and patents for the first smart mailbox for drone delivery. Through systematic research, development, and deep customer collaboration, we've evolved to today where we deploy Arrive Points—a type of smart locker and mini-cross-docks for frictionless drone, robotic, and courier delivery and pickup, utilized from medical supplies to meals to e-commerce. Arrive AI is now growing and investing to scale an ALM network and platform of the future for all autonomous delivery providers, services, and customers. Arrive AI is the intelligent choice for the last inch of the Autonomous Last Mile™.

The Role:
We are seeking a Senior Mechanical Engineer to lead the evolution and scaling of our next-generation autonomous delivery hardware. This is a high-impact, hands-on role for a technical architect who thrives at the intersection of physical design, robotic intelligence, and systemic reliability. You will own the mechanical integrity of our Arrive Point hardware, moving fluidly between digital twin simulation, rapid prototyping, and large-scale manufacturing oversight. In this role, you aren't just designing parts; you are engineering the physical foundation for autonomous intelligence. You will balance the "speed vs. rigor" trade-off, ensuring that our AI-driven features—from robotics intelligence to predictive sensors—are robust, manufacturable, and field-ready.
Design Digitally First:
Use expert-level CAD (Creo preferred) and simulation tools to concept, validate, and iterate. You'll lead "digital-first" workflows to accelerate development and eliminate costly physical revisions
Coordinate Across Disciplines:
Work hand-in-hand with Electrical, Robotics, and Systems engineers. You will lead the "war room" conversations, resolving technical trade-offs to ensure seamless integration of PCBs, sensors, and compute modules.
Accelerate Prototype-to-Production Cycles:
Oversee high-velocity prototyping to test features and enhance current builds based on real-world field data, while simultaneously partnering with external design firms and Contract Manufacturers (CMs) to ensure those innovations are optimized for unit economics, DFM, and high-volume.
Technical Leadership:
Provide mentorship to the engineering team, fostering a culture of rigorous problem-solving, documentation excellence, and creative engineering.
Compensation:
Salary is market competitive with high equity incentive - be an owner and grow with Arrive AI.
Requirements:
5+ years of experience in mechanical engineering, preferably in robotics or autonomous systems. Strong CAD proficiency (Creo preferred) and experience designing for manufacturability. Proven success working with contract manufacturers and design partners. Comfort moving between design, hands-on prototyping, and documentation. Experience working in fast-paced, iterative environments with evolving requirements. Familiarity with AI-powered or IoT-integrated hardware is a plus.
